Chicago Bulls Betting Preview
The Chicago Bulls have been in fine form as they’ve won five of their last nine games overall and they will be feeling pretty good after they snapped a three-game losing streak with a 125-118 win last night. Ayo Dosunmu led the team with 29 points, eight rebounds and nine assists on 11 of 16 shooting, Matas Buzelis added 21 points with eight rebounds and four assists while Isaac Okoro chipped in with 20 points.
As a team, the Bulls shot 52 percent from the field and a sizzling 20 of 40 from the 3-point line as they dominated the third quarter by 35-21 to overcome an 11-point deficit. However, the game was tied late in the fourth quarter before the Bulls closed the final 1:12 on a 9-2 run to avenge their loss to the Heat in the previous meeting.
Miami Heat Betting Preview
Meanwhile, the Miami Heat have been in decent shape as they’ve won six of their last 11 games overall, but they will be out for revenge after falling short to the Bulls in a tough loss last night. Pelle Larsson led the team with 22 points, seven rebounds, four assists and five steals, Bam Adebayo added 21 points with 11 rebounds while Jaime Jacquez Jr chipped in with 20 points and seven assists off the bench.
As a team, the Heat shot 43 percent from the field and 13 of 48 from the 3-point line as they exploded for 38 points in the second quarter to open up an 11-point lead. However, they allowed the Bulls back into the contest and just couldn’t make their shots in the clutch when it mattered most. Simone Fontecchio had a quiet game of just eight points on three of 10 shooting while Nikola Jovic shot just one of six for his two points.

The Bulls are still missing Zach Collins and Tre Jones, but they could have Josh Giddey, Jalen Smith, Coby White, and Nikola Vucevic all return. Meanwhile, the Heat are expecting to have Tyler Herro, Norman Powell, and Davion Mitchell return to the lineup.
